Transaction 24039e9f38ba9cc980359288e7798b76a7f2eb3cbd62f5fa88247402634dba36
2 Input
2 Outputs
- 24039e9f38ba9cc980359288e7798b76a7f2eb3cbd62f5fa88247402634dba36:0
- 24039e9f38ba9cc980359288e7798b76a7f2eb3cbd62f5fa88247402634dba36:1
value 1153970
address 35RqP9KbZyQcib4R47n6NuJpg1Lckq5L36
value 310788
address 17mg573HZXRX269NrDFJm2agBWdHRDSKwX